Responsibilities
- Assist patients with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ting.
- Monitor and record vital signs, including blood pressure, temperature, pulse, and respiration rates.
- Observe and report any changes in a patient's physical or emotional condition to the nursing staff immediately.
- Move patients safely using proper body mechanics and mobility aids (walkers, wheelchairs).
- Prepare and serve meals, ensuring dietary restrictions and feeding assistance are met.
- Maintain a clean, organized, and safe patient environment by following sanitation protocols.
- Communicate effectively with patients, families, and healthcare team members to ensure quality care.
